Description

Cheshire East Borough Council seek to commission a Service which will offer secure, sustainable support to all children and young people who may need advice or help in order to achieve emotional wellbeing. The Commissioners require a Provider for the management, co-ordination and provision of an Emotionally Healthy Children and Young People Service.
The scope of the Service will include children and young people who are resident in Cheshire East Borough or who attend a school within the Cheshire East region.
